3DMark 11 Performance GPU

3DMark 11 is an obsolete DirectX 11 benchmark by Futuremark. It used four tests based on two scenes, one being few submarines exploring the submerged wreck of a sunken ship, the other is an abandoned temple deep in the jungle. All the tests are heavy with volumetric lighting and tessellation, and despite being done in 1280x720 resolution, are relatively taxing. Discontinued in January 2020, 3DMark 11 is now superseded by Time Spy.

Pros & cons summary


Performance score 3.76 20.77
Recency 5 September 2018 27 May 2019
Maximum RAM amount 2 GB 4 GB
Chip lithography 14 nm 12 nm
Power consumption (TDP) 50 Watt 60 Watt

Radeon 540X has 20% lower power consumption.

T2000 Mobile, on the other hand, has a 452.4% higher aggregate performance score, an age advantage of 8 months, a 100% higher maximum VRAM amount, and a 16.7% more advanced lithography process.

The Quadro T2000 Mobile is our recommended choice as it beats the Radeon 540X in performance tests.

Be aware that Radeon 540X is a notebook graphics card while Quadro T2000 Mobile is a mobile workstation one.
